Another option is a tool like the FACOM wind-up impact wrench. No batteries, even. You set it all up like a breaker bar, then wind
it round till it lets go. Exactly the same effect as an air impact wrench, just takes a littlel longer.
Big disadvantage - you need space to turn it. This is NOT a restricted space tool.
